EDITORS COMMENTS
This woodcut print, titled "Nineve" is a stunning depiction of the ancient city of Nineveh from Hartmann Schedel's Liber Chronicarum. Created in 1493 by an anonymous German artist, this artwork showcases the remarkable talent and attention to detail prevalent during the 15th century. The image transports us back in time to the Middle Ages, where we witness the grandeur of Nineveh's walls and gateways. The towering entrance gates stand as formidable structures, guarding access to this bustling cityscape. Statues adorn these magnificent walls, adding an air of majesty and cultural significance. As our eyes wander through this medieval metropolis, we are captivated by the intricate architecture that comprises Nineveh. The buildings rise proudly against the sky, showcasing their unique designs and craftsmanship. Each structure tells a story of its own within this historical tapestry. Hartmann Schedel's Nuremberg Chronicle was renowned for its comprehensive account of world history up until that point. This woodcut print serves as a visual representation of his meticulous research and dedication to capturing historical accuracy. Today, this print remains part of a private collection known as The Stapleton Collection. Its presence reminds us not only of ancient civilizations but also pays homage to Schedel's significant contributions as a physician, humanist, historian, and cartographer.
